POST api/Seal/Seal
Seal PDF or XML document
Request Information
URI Parameters
None.
Body Parameters
SealRequest| Name | Description | Type | Additional information |
|---|---|---|---|
| Document | Collection of byte |
None. |
|
| Info | SealInfo |
None. |
|
| Type | SignatureType |
None. |
|
| CertificateAlias | string |
None. |
|
| DigestMethod | string |
None. |
|
| AddPage | boolean |
None. |
|
| Signers | Collection of PdfSigner |
None. |
Request Formats
application/json, text/json
Sample:
{
"Document": "QEA=",
"Info": {
"FieldName": "sample string 1",
"Reason": "sample string 2",
"Location": "sample string 3",
"Contact": "sample string 4",
"XLocation": 5,
"YLocation": 6,
"Width": 7,
"Height": 8,
"Page": 9,
"Logo": "QEA=",
"Border": true,
"Font": "sample string 11",
"FontSize": 12,
"TextXMargin": 13,
"TextYMargin": 14,
"ImgXMargin": 15,
"ImgYMargin": 16,
"Template": "sample string 17"
},
"Type": 0,
"CertificateAlias": "sample string 1",
"DigestMethod": "sample string 2",
"AddPage": true,
"Signers": [
{
"Name": "sample string 1",
"SigningMessage": "sample string 2"
},
{
"Name": "sample string 1",
"SigningMessage": "sample string 2"
}
]
}
application/xml, text/xml
Sample:
<SealR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Advania.Model.Signet.V2">
<AddPage>true</AddPage>
<CertificateAlias>sample string 1</CertificateAlias>
<DigestMethod>sample string 2</DigestMethod>
<Document>QEA=</Document>
<Info>
<Border>true</Border>
<Contact>sample string 4</Contact>
<FieldName>sample string 1</FieldName>
<Font>sample string 11</Font>
<FontSize>12</FontSize>
<Height>8</Height>
<ImgXMargin>15</ImgXMargin>
<ImgYMargin>16</ImgYMargin>
<Location>sample string 3</Location>
<Logo>QEA=</Logo>
<Page>9</Page>
<Reason>sample string 2</Reason>
<Template>sample string 17</Template>
<TextXMargin>13</TextXMargin>
<TextYMargin>14</TextYMargin>
<Width>7</Width>
<XLocation>5</XLocation>
<YLocation>6</YLocation>
</Info>
<Signers>
<SealRequest.PdfSigner>
<Name>sample string 1</Name>
<SigningMessage>sample string 2</SigningMessage>
</SealRequest.PdfSigner>
<SealRequest.PdfSigner>
<Name>sample string 1</Name>
<SigningMessage>sample string 2</SigningMessage>
</SealRequest.PdfSigner>
</Signers>
<Type>PAdES_BES</Type>
</SealRequest>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
IHttpActionResultNone.
Response Formats
application/json, text/json, application/xml, text/xml
Sample:
Sample not available.